  • Mean (SD) or % (N). Hypertension defined as diastolic blood pressure ≥90 mm Hg or systolic blood pressure ≥140 mm Hg or use of any antihypertensive medication in the past 2 weeks. Cardiovascular disease defined as self-reported history of stroke or coronary heart disease (previous myocardial infarction, coronary heart disease or ECG confirmation of previous myocardial infarction). Diabetes defined as self-report of doctor diagnosis, use of glucose-lowering medication, fasting blood glucose ≥126 mg/dL or non-fasting blood glucose ≥200 mg/dL. To convert lipids from mg/dL to mmol/L, divide by 38.67 for total cholesterol, HDL-C and LDL-C, and by 88.57 for triglycerides.
